Heads up — this fires when the Tindervale query planner starts choosing sequential scans on tables it previously indexed, usually after a stats refresh goes sideways. It matters to you because degraded plans have historically been used to amplify slow-query DoS attempts against the tenant API. Check whether the regression correlates with unusual query shapes from a single tenant before assuming it's benign drift. Don't silence it for more than an hour. Triage steps and the plan-diff tooling are documented on the internal page right below.

dashboard of bafof-hafog = https://confluence.lumiclabs.internal/display/browse/display/6a09a20a

## Validator Plugins — Onboarding Notes

The Corbelware platform loads data validators as plugins from the registry at startup. Each plugin declares a schema version and a checksum; mismatches are rejected by the Hatchgate loader. Maintainers should never hot-patch a validator in production — publish a new plugin version instead. To publish, you need write access to the signing vault. The vault unlocks with a recovery passphrase, which appears on the next line.

unlock words, tawif-tahop: oliys-ulawyn-tamdor-lamys-casox-jormir-fraius-kasath-ulador-ulamir-holir-sorys-holeth

## Changelog — Font vendoring defaults changed

As of this release, the Bracken UI build no longer fetches third-party fonts at build time. All typefaces used by the Lanternwell suite are now vendored into the repo under a dedicated assets directory, and the fetch step is skipped by default. If you're onboarding, nothing to install — the fonts travel with the checkout. The build flags controlling this behavior are listed below.

settings of hadup-yafog:
LAMAEL_PIN=3761
LAMAEL_TENANT=istmir
LAMAEL_METRICS_HOST=metrics.lamael.plorvasys.test
LAMAEL_SEAL=seal_8ea68500
LAMAEL_STANDBY_TEAM=fraok

# Who to Contact: Log Sampling for Chattervane

The Chattervane service emits roughly forty million log lines daily, so sampling policy changes must not be made unilaterally. All adjustments to sampling rates go through the Observability Guild at Pellam Software, who maintain the retention budget and the downstream alerting thresholds. Before proposing any change, read the sampling policy page. Questions about current rates should be sent here.

billing contact of yawip-yadup = druath.casdor@nelvrolabs.internal